Leash Types for Different Situations
**Standard 6-foot leash:** The everyday essential. Best for neighbourhood walks and on-leash park areas like Fish Creek.
**Long training lead (15-30 feet):** Essential for recall training at parks like Nose Hill. Gives your dog freedom while maintaining control.
**Hands-free waist leash:** Perfect for trail running along the Bow River pathway. Absorbs shock and keeps hands free.
**Retractable leash:** Controversial but useful in some situations. NOT recommended for large breeds due to injury risk. The thin cord can cause burns and cuts.

Weight Ratings
For large breeds (Labs, Shepherds, Rottweilers), choose leashes rated for at least 50 kg pulling force. Budget leashes often have weak clips that fail under a strong lunge.
